Finale Breckenridge: A New Era of Slopeside Luxury

Finale Breckenridge marks a defining moment for mountain real estate in Summit County. Set at the base of Peak 8, this master-planned resort brings together the Imperial Hotel, private chalets, and slopeside residences in one of the most coveted locations in town. Opportunities like this have become increasingly rare as developable land continues to disappear.

Breckenridge’s ski-in, ski-out inventory has steadily declined over the years. Because of that, Finale Breckenridge stands out as one of the last projects offering true direct access to the slopes. The Imperial Hotel, expected to open in phases beginning in 2027, may also be the final new ski-in, ski-out hotel built in Breckenridge.

Intimate Design With Direct Mountain Access

Rather than following the scale of older resort developments, the Imperial Hotel focuses on a more personal alpine experience. The project includes just 36 hotel rooms, a select number of fractional residences, and a limited collection of fully owned chalets along the mountainside.

Residences Built for Long-Term Enjoyment

The Imperial Chalets within Finale Breckenridge begin at just over $4 million and include two- to five-bedroom layouts designed for year-round living. Architecture by DTJ Design blends modern structure with classic mountain materials, while interiors by Styleworks add warmth and texture.

This hybrid ownership model continues to gain traction among luxury buyers. It offers the independence of a private home paired with concierge services, dining access, and professional property management. As a result, owners can enjoy both privacy and ease.

Wellness and Amenities That Feel Like Home

Wellness anchors the experience at Finale Breckenridge. The Remedy Spa supports recovery and altitude adjustment, while the Fire and Ice Grotto delivers a hydrothermal circuit inspired by European traditions. These features support an active, year-round lifestyle.

More than 70,000 square feet of shared amenities extend living space beyond each residence. Indoor and outdoor pools, fitness studios, private lounges, and cinema rooms create a sense of community without sacrificing exclusivity.
